Grid Studio Framed Smartphones

Grid Studio Framed Smartphones

While we absolutely love most aspects of the current, connected world that modern smartphones give us access to, there’s something to be said for the nostalgia of previous devices. We don’t have any desire to use an iPhone 3GS, 4S, or 5, BlackBerry Bold 9000, iPod Touch, or even the Nokia E71–because most of them wouldn’t be capable of utilizing the latest versions of our favorite apps, if they could even get on the modern networks we pay for–but we still long for the nostalgia they bring. That’s where Grid Studio Frames come in. Grid takes your favorite old school devices, breaks them down into technical specification level setups and frames them in a shadowbox so you can enjoy all your former favorites as pieces of art. These technical collages are a sight to behold and, if we’re being honest, they’re far more affordable than picking up a lightbox and attempting to do it yourself.
